Full job description
Main responsibilities:
- Drive end-to-end execution of complex robotic programs for Robust’s product portfolio
- Drive and motivate the cross-functional team to deliver the product as per the requirements and timeline
- Drive accountability of cross-functional teams, including hardware, software, and deployment
- Manage requirements for deployment sites and communicate new requirements to the relevant engineering teams
- Responsible for creating project plans for deployment, including the schedule, timeline and resourcing
- Communicate program status regularly to the leadership team, anticipate bottlenecks, provide escalation management, anticipate and make trade-offs, and balance the business needs versus technical constraints
What you’ll bring to the table:
-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or related/equivalent work experience
- 7+ years of experience managing complex technical projects with aggressive schedules
- Proficient at creating and tracking complex program schedules, managing issues and tracking bugs
- Able to take large, complex projects and break them down into manageable pieces, develop functional specifications, then deliver them in a timely manner
- Excellent leadership skills
- Excellent communication skills
- Familiar with Agile program management
- Familiar with product development lifecycles
